About the team

Engineering recruiting at Databricks comprises a team of talent acquisition specialists dedicated to helping clients identify, attract, and hire the most qualified engineering talent. Our team is geographically distributed, with a presence in the San Francisco Bay Area, Washington, and other remote locations throughout the US. Collectively, we are responsible for identifying, attracting, and recruiting engineering candidates who are transforming Databricks' product development during this critical growth stage. Our clients are the Engineering Leadership Team and their managers. This role will be responsible for building sourcing strategies and pipelines for all Software engineering roles, including Frontend and Backend roles across North America.

The Impact you'll have:

The Engineering Sourcing Manager will partner with engineering hiring managers, technical leaders, and recruiting managers to set and drive strategy, goals, and processes for their sourcing team focused on Backend and Frontend engineering pipelines. This leader will support their team in all aspects of the search process, ranging from preparation for client meetings, including market research and drafting specifications; developing search strategies; identifying, researching, and contacting prospective candidates; creating status reports and candidate assessments; and leading weekly status calls on sourcing deliverables.

About Databricks

Databricks is the data and AI company. More than 10,000 organizations worldwide — including Comcast, Condé Nast, Grammarly, and over 50% of the Fortune 500 — rely on the Databricks Data Intelligence Platform to unify and democratize data, analytics and AI. Databricks is headquartered in San Francisco, with offices around the globe and was founded by the original creators of Lakehouse, Apache Spark™, Delta Lake and MLflow.
